Sponge Cake Perfection: The Secret’s in the Whisking 🍰

Sponge cake has always been about precision. The texture relies on how well the eggs are beaten and how gently the flour is folded in. Room temperature eggs make a difference—cold eggs just don’t whip up as airy. Sifting the flour twice keeps the crumb light and avoids lumps. I use a stand mixer for the eggs and sugar, letting it run until the mixture is pale and triples in volume. That’s the moment to fold in the flour by hand, using a spatula, and never over-mixing. Baking at 350°F for about 25 minutes gives a golden top and a soft, springy interior. Once cooled, it’s easy to slice and layer with whipped cream or fruit. The clean, simple flavor of homemade sponge cake stands out without needing heavy frostings.
